To qualify as official development assistance (ODA), development loans which are concessional in nature must have a grant element of at least 25 percent, calculated using a stated annual interest rate of 10 percent. Suppose Canada Infrastructure Bank has decided to consider a development loan to Argentina, Qatar World Cup Champion 2022, for its sports infrastructure development. The loan under consideration is as follows: $50,000,000 to be amortized over 8 years by 16 semi-annual payments, after a grace period of 5 years during which only interest would be paid semi-annually. This loan would charge interest at a stated annual rate of 6 percent. 1) II) Determine whether this loan would qualify as ODA. What is the maximum interest rate that could be charged for this loan to qualify as ODA? Note: Show all working steps clearly. (Important Note: Use a rate of 5% or 7% if you want to decrease or increase the subsidized rate for the calculation of maximum rate. Justify the change of your rate.)
